David Thomas Crowe, a New York actor who had just received his Actors' Equity card this year, died of a heart attack at his home in the Bronx Nov. 7. He was 45.
His New York stage credits include Feste in Twelfth Night, Roger Sherman in 1776, and the title role in Bullshot Crummond.
